Pricing Guidelines for the U.S Gold Centennial Coins Announced
2016-04-29 Fri
Pricing guidelines for the gold centennial coins — the 2016-W Winged Liberty Head dime, Standing Liberty quarter dollar and Walking Liberty half dollar — has been set by the U.S. Mint as per a notice posted on the Federal Register on 15th April.The Winged Liberty Head gold dime will be priced at just over $200 per coin. Mintage of this coin is limited to 125,000 and they were up for sale starting 21st April. It contains a tenth-ounce of 24-karat gold. The Standing Liberty quarter dollar will be a quarter-ounce pure gold piece and the gold half dollar will be a half-ounce pure gold coin. Maximum mintages and release dates of these coins has not yet been disclosed.
